How to fill out policies and procedures for

How to fill out policies and procedures for
01
Start by identifying the key processes and activities within your organization that require policies and procedures.
02
Gather information and documentation related to these processes, such as industry standards, legal requirements, and best practices.
03
Outline the purpose and objectives of each policy and procedure.
04
Define the scope of each policy and procedure, including the departments, roles, and individuals affected.
05
Specify the step-by-step instructions and guidelines for carrying out each process, including any necessary forms, templates, or tools.
06
Incorporate any compliance requirements, safety guidelines, or quality control measures that are relevant to the process.
07
Review and revise the policies and procedures to ensure clarity, consistency, and alignment with organizational goals.
08
Communicate the policies and procedures to all relevant stakeholders, providing training and support as needed.
09
Regularly update and maintain the policies and procedures to reflect any changes in regulations, technology, or industry best practices.
